"Syed" is a Muslim given name. It is derived from the Muslim title "Sayyid". In Spain the persons name would still be spelled and pronounced the same way. Another way to describe a given name is to call it a "Christian" name. Christian names are generally associated with specific Christian Saints. So St. James in English is San Diego in Spanish for example. Syed is a given name, but not a Christian name, so there is no equivalent in Spanish
